Una regla pr\u00e1ctica es que cuanto m\u00e1s duro es el material, menos se requerir\u00e1 reducir la pared para lograr una uni\u00f3n de los tubos.<\/h4>\n<\/div><div class=\"fusion-clearfix\"><\/div><\/div><\/div><\/div><\/div><div class=\"fusion-fullwidth fullwidth-box fusion-builder-row-2 nonhundred-percent-fullwidth non-hundred-percent-height-scrolling\" style=\"--awb-border-radius-top-left:0px;--awb-border-radius-top-right:0px;--awb-border-radius-bottom-right:0px;--awb-border-radius-bottom-left:0px;\" ><div class=\"fusion-builder-row fusion-row\"><div class=\"fusion-layout-column fusion_builder_column fusion-builder-column-1 fusion_builder_column_1_1 1_1 fusion-one-full fusion-column-first fusion-column-last\" style=\"--awb-bg-size:cover;--awb-margin-top:20px;\"><div class=\"fusion-column-wrapper fusion-flex-column-wrapper-legacy\"><div class=\"fusion-text fusion-text-2\"><p>A continuaci\u00f3n hay pautas que se han usado en la industria a lo largo de los a\u00f1os. Estas de ninguna manera son recomendaciones para todos los equipos de transferencia de calor, pero se ofrecen como sugerencias generales. Consulte siempre al fabricante del recipiente de transferencia de calor para obtener m\u00e1s informaci\u00f3n antes de iniciar cualquier procedimiento de mantenimiento.<\/p>\n<p>Al expandir los tubos, para incrementar la vida \u00fatil de la herramienta y la calidad de la expansi\u00f3n, es importante lubricar cada tubo y asegurarse de que el interior de los tubos y los expansores de tubos se mantengan limpios.<\/p>\n<h4 class=\"ett-red\">Acero, acero al carbono y almirantazgo<\/h4>\n<p>El almirantazgo se utiliza ampliamente en condensadores. La pared del tubo debe reducirse aproximadamente en un 6 &#8211; 9% para lograr uniones \u00f3ptimas del tubo. Rodar a una mayor reducci\u00f3n de la pared puede causar fugas, divisiones o tubos descamados.<\/p>\n<p>El acero al carbono se utiliza en casi todos los tipos de recipientes a presi\u00f3n fabricados en la actualidad. La reducci\u00f3n de la pared del tubo debe ser de aproximadamente 5 &#8211; 8%. Si el tubo se est\u00e1 agrietando o si las herramientas muestran desgaste excesivo, se debe verificar la dureza del tubo. Los tubos de acero al carbono deben tener una dureza de 90 a 120 Brinnel para el laminado. Es posible laminar tubos de hasta 150 Brinnel, sin embargo, es m\u00e1s probable que se produzcan descamaciones y grietas a medida que aumenta la dureza del tubo.<\/p>\n<h4 class=\"ett-red\">Cobre y cupron\u00edquel<\/h4>\n<p>Al laminar cobre y cupron\u00edquel, considere aproximadamente un 7 &#8211; 10% de reducci\u00f3n de pared para obtener una junta de tubo adecuada. Como el cobre es uno de los tubos m\u00e1s blandos que se usan en los recipientes a presi\u00f3n, se puede laminar f\u00e1cilmente.<\/p>\n<h4 class=\"ett-red\">Acero inoxidable y titanio<\/h4>\n<p>Cuando se laminan tubos de acero inoxidable y titanio, aproximadamente 4 &#8211; 6% de reducci\u00f3n de pared es suficiente para producir una junta de tubo segura. Al laminar estas aleaciones, la reducci\u00f3n total de la pared debe hacerse r\u00e1pidamente, ya que tienen una mayor tendencia a endurecerse al trabajarse.<\/p>\n<p>Al laminar titanio, a menudo se recomienda usar un expansor de cuatro o cinco rollos. Esto reducir\u00e1 el diafragma de una pared delgada y ayudar\u00e1 a eliminar el agrietamiento en el extremo del tubo.<\/p>\n<h4 class=\"ett-red\">Aluminio<\/h4>\n<p>Al laminar aluminio 3003 o 4004, no deber\u00eda reducir las paredes m\u00e1s del 5%.
